Pours an opaque dark amber color with a creamy khaki head that is thick at first but thins quickly into a light film. Aroma is full of pumpkin spices and malt. Taste follows the nose at first, with pumpkin and spice and lots of dark malt flavors. Then the sweetness comes in, with a vanilla creaminess that is very lactose in nature. The brandy barrel aging is apparent too, with a candy-like sweetness that really picks up on the back-end. It's slightly boozy, but the 9.5% ABV doesn't overwhelm the complex flavors from the beer. Drinking this beer makes us think that barrel aging might be the key to making a great Pumpkin Beer. This is smooth and creamy with the right amount of pumpkin and spices, making this one of our top choices during Pumpkin Beer season.
